Impact of gamma radiation on vegetative and bud characters of Lilium hybrid cv. Zambesi in vM2 generation

Abstract:
An experiment was conducted to study the impact of gamma radiation on vegetative and bud characteristics of Lilium hybrid cv. Zambesi in vM2 generation during the year 2020-2021. The experiment consisted of randomized block design with four treatments. The result revealed that in vM2 generation different gamma ray doses had major effect on the vegetative and bud parameters. Generally the treated population had reduction in all the parameters in vM2 generation compared to control. Maximum plant height, leaf length and leaf width were observed in T1 (control) except number of leaves per plant recorded highest in T2 while minimum was observed in T4. Similarly days to bud appearance and bud break were delayed at higher doses of gamma ray (viz. 3.5 gy and 5.5 gy) compared to control. Number of bud per plant and bud length recorded highest in control except bud width where increase was seen in treatment T2.
